Smooth Running of Processing Facilities

With automation systems, a vast amount of information can be collected from thousands of locations within a facility. If these systems were not automated, it would be virtually impossible for operators to keep on top of everything. Any issues would usually only be noticed when things had begun to malfunction. With systems that constantly monitor, many negative situations are avoided. These include things like machines being jammed by products etc, and machines overloading or breaking down.

Competition is fierce within the flour industry, so functioning and earning must continue during manufacturing. This highlights the importance of a good automation system to ensure processing facilities run smoothly.

Remotely Controlled Automation Using Smart Phones, Tablets & Computers

Another major advantage of these automated systems, is the fact that they can be controlled remotely using smart phones, computers and tablets. As well as notification of failures, instructions, reports and updates can be recorded and communicated via these systems. Installing an automation system in some older facilities may be extremely difficult due to their design. It may however be possible if the mechanical infrastructure can be changed, and the automation system adapted.

When facilities are originally designed and installed, it’s wise to consider potential upgrading processes in the future. This would mean a swift and low cost installation where needed. There would also be less downtime which for a flour mill can be extremely expensive.
